Bangholm Bower Avenue is an avenue in North Edinburgh and is mainly residential.
Dunedin Studios is a photography company specialising in advertising and commercial photography.
Address: 10 Bangholm Bower Avenue, Edinburgh, Midlothian, EH5 3NS
Map showing Bangholm Bower Avenue in Edinburgh.